In LDPlayer, the macro command feature enables you to record your actions and replay them at will. The process is simple: you can record a sequence of clicks, movements, and key presses that you can activate during gameplay. This can be particularly useful in resource-heavy games where grinding is required to advance. With LDPlayer's user-friendly interface, even beginners can set up macros without hassle.

1. BlueStacks: The Veteran Emulator BlueStacks has been a leader in the Android emulator space for years. It offers a user-friendly interface and robust performance, making it suitable for both casual gamers and developers. With its recent updates, BlueStacks has improved its gaming performance, adding features like high frame rate support and customizable game controls.
